About Anrê
Anrê offers a distinctive path for parents drawn to names with a deep-rooted significance and a resonant, contemporary feel. This masculine name, with its Greek origins pointing to "man" or "warrior," carries an inherent strength and a quiet, steadfast dignity. While it shares its lineage with the widely recognized Andrew, Anrê stands out with its unique phonetic spelling, "ahn-RAY," giving it an exotic yet approachable quality.
